Common Smile Concerns That Cosmetic Dentistry Can Address
Many people assume cosmetic dentistry only focuses on whitening teeth, but it actually addresses several types of smile concerns.
Tooth discoloration is one of the most common issues. Over time, coffee, tea, red wine, and certain foods can stain enamel and make teeth appear dull. Professional whitening treatments can help lift these stains and restore a brighter appearance.
Another concern involves chipped or uneven teeth. Small cracks or worn edges can change the way a smile looks. Cosmetic dental treatments can reshape or restore the tooth surface so the smile appears more balanced.
Spacing and alignment can also affect the overall look of a smile. When teeth appear crowded or uneven, some cosmetic procedures can help improve the appearance and symmetry of the smile.

Popular Cosmetic Dentistry Treatments
Several types of cosmetic dental treatments are available depending on the condition of the teeth and the goals of the patient.
Teeth whitening is one of the most commonly requested cosmetic procedures. Professional whitening treatments can remove stains that build up over time and help restore a brighter appearance.
Porcelain veneers are another popular option. Veneers are thin coverings placed on the front of teeth to improve their shape, color, and overall appearance. They are often used to address discoloration, chips, or uneven spacing.
Dental bonding may also be used to repair small imperfections such as chips or minor gaps. This treatment involves applying a tooth colored material that blends with the natural tooth surface.
Each treatment option works differently, and a dental consultation can help determine which approach may be appropriate.

Understanding Cosmetic Dentistry Options
Before choosing a cosmetic treatment, dentists typically examine the teeth and discuss the patient’s goals. This helps determine whether the concern involves surface stains, enamel wear, or structural changes in the teeth.
In some situations, professional cleaning or whitening may be enough to improve tooth appearance. In other cases, treatments such as veneers may be considered when deeper discoloration or visible tooth damage is present.
Understanding these options helps patients make informed decisions about their dental care and the improvements they would like to see in their smile.
Maintaining Your Smile After Cosmetic Treatment
After cosmetic dental treatment, maintaining healthy habits becomes very important. Brushing twice a day and flossing daily helps protect the results of many cosmetic procedures.
Reducing foods and drinks that stain teeth may also help keep teeth looking brighter. Drinking water after coffee or tea can help wash away staining particles.
Regular dental visits allow dentists to monitor oral health and maintain the appearance of cosmetic treatments over time.

FAQs
What is cosmetic dentistry and how does it help confidence?
Cosmetic dentistry focuses on improving the appearance of teeth, gums, and smiles. When people feel comfortable with the way their teeth look, they often feel more confident in social and professional situations.
Which cosmetic dental treatments improve the look of teeth?
Common cosmetic treatments include teeth whitening, porcelain veneers, and dental bonding. These procedures can help improve tooth color, shape, and overall smile appearance.
How do porcelain veneers improve a smile?
Porcelain veneers are thin shells placed on the front surface of teeth. They can cover stains, chips, uneven edges, and spacing issues to create a more even and brighter smile.
What should I ask during a cosmetic dentistry consultation?
You may ask which treatment can improve your smile concerns, how long results may last, and what steps are needed to maintain the appearance after treatment.
How can I maintain my smile after cosmetic dental treatment?
Maintaining good oral hygiene, limiting staining foods and drinks, and visiting the dentist regularly can help protect the results of cosmetic dental procedures.
